Some babies make the transition early, and some do it later.  My DS transitioned at 6 months, but my DD transitioned at around 8 months.

It all depends on your lo.  You would start the transition when your lo starts loosing interest in the mid morning feed or the afternoon feed.  The first feed you would look at dropping is the mid morning feed (the 11ish one).

You would drop this one, and perhaps move lunch earlier to say 11:30 ish, so that your lo does not get too hungry.  You can then move the afternoon feed up to around 2:00 / 2:30ish.

Our routine looked something like this:-

7:00 - Bottle
8:00ish - Cereal
11:15ish - Lunch
2:00 / 2:30ish depending on nap - bottle
4:30 - dinner
7:00 - bottle and then straight to bed.
